From Chengdu to Grothendieck
" Mathand engineeringengineering at theUniversityof Montpellier: fromfundamental theories to modern applications ” is the theme of the 2026 Winter School organized by the Faculty of Sciences at theUM , which is hosting a delegation of Chinese students from the University of Electronic Science and Technology of China (UESTC) in Chengdu from February 2 to 7.

Inaugurated by François Pierrot, vice president for international relations at theUM, this event is organized under the auspices of two leading scientific figures from Montpellier: Alexander Grothendieck, who revolutionized algebraic geometry and embodied the power of pure mathematical abstraction, and Jean-Jacques Moreau, the founder of convex analysis and non-smooth mechanics, whose ideas paved the way for modern modeling of granular and divided media.
The program for this Winter School, organized by Professors Adam Ali and Émilien Azéma, includes lectures, presentations, and tours highlighting the unique nature of Montpellier’s scientific landscape, which bridges mathematical thought, engineering, and innovation.
